Without knowing it, I took the opposite direction of his trade at the Open for a quick momentum scalp. SW got long at 19.01 against the important 19 level. I got short into it. When I was reviewing my tape, he asked me \u201cWhy did you short into that held bid?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>My answer: \u201cBecause the seller could crush that bid and I could capture an explosive move to the downside. Plus the volume was done at .02, 19 hasn&#8217;t really proven itself\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Let me explain the trade: On the first ticks, we traded up to 19 where there was a held offer. The prints sped up and the volume came in. 19 lifted. We traded almost immediately to 19.14. There was no chance for someone looking for size to grab a lot of shares between after this offer lifted. Within 30 seconds, we traded higher to 19.30, while skipping a lot of prices. This is a move that tells us the stock is not very liquid, at least not yet. It also foreshadows that the stock could have other explosive moves, in either direction.<\/p>\n<p>After this quick upmove, JBL returned to 19 within a minute. At first, I was looking at this as a potential buying opportunity. The short-term momentum was to the upside and we returned to a key breakout price. However, I am very weary of a stock returning to the same price too often, or failing to move away after a catalyst. I replaced my bid box with an offer box to hit the bids when the .03 seller lifted (this was supposed to be the catalyst to move away from 19) and came back. If this stock is truly strong, they should battle 19 and I&#8217;ll have time to see the buying and get out.<\/p>\n<p>This is a not a trade that will make anyone&#8217;s trading career. It&#8217;s just an insignificant piker scalp trade. But I bring it up because it demonstrates a couple of important concepts: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>Developing an understanding of the present liquidity in a stock \u2013 Ask yourself \u201cwhat&#8217;s underneath 19 if that bid drops?\u201d You should have this thought implanted in your subconscious anytime you decide to get in front of held bids\/offers on the Open, in order to have a better approximation of your risk-reward.<\/li>\n<li>Knowing your trading psychology \u2013 Which side is potentially trapped at that moment?
